Daily brief
Russia launched one of its largest drone attacks on Ukraine in a single day, firing nearly 1,000 drones within 24 hours. The assault killed at least eight people and wounded dozens, with strikes reported around Kyiv and other regions. NATO scrambled fighter jets in response to the massive aerial attack, which analysts see as a signal of a ramping up of Russian offensive operations.
